Wild:              
The Oculudentavis, also known as Narcler, is living peacefully in the deepest caves of Aberration, because of it‘s poison, aggressive creatures don‘t attack it, but it’s although really jumpy and runs away when it sees a danger. It mostly consumes small insects near them, but also absorbes torpor from unconscious creatures to survive, so try to don‘t knock out creatures near the Narcler, because he will definitely try to consume the torpor. It is really rare and is also hard to find because of it‘s colour, which is adapted to the vegetation and colours of Aberration. The Narcler is one of the few creatures which can easily survive the poison and radiation of Aberration. 
    
Domesticated:       
Once the Narcler is tamed, it serves you as a loyal, poisonous shoulder pet and brings a lot of useful abilities with it to make your live on Aberration and on generally every Ark easier.

  • The Narcler is having a torpor storage, which fills itself up, when consuming Torpor from creatures or survivors, or when it gets fed things which raise torpor (for example narcoberries), it is important to know, that the torpor storage is having a limit.
  • When it is on your shoulder, the Narcler is able to suck out torpor from you, to cause that you don‘t get unconscious, for example when you get attacked from a Titanoboa or with tranquilizer darts from other survivors. This works until the torpor storage from the Narcler is full.
  • With the help of the torpor of it‘s storage, the Narcler is able to spit the torpor at opponents to make them unconscious, this also works with taming other creatures.
  • With it‘s torpor storage the Narcler is also able to heal the survivor a bit, by consuming the torpor from the storage (only works when it is having torpor in its storage)
  • When the Narclers storage is full, it gives the survivor and the ridden creature a buff for speed, stamina and strength (when the storage is no longer full, the effect stays for 30 seconds)
  • The last but not least abilitiy from the Narcler is creating narcotics in his inventory, by using rotten flesh and the torpor from its storage, the Narcler produces narcotics much faster than the mortar an pestle.       

Domestication:       
The taming of the Narcler is a little bit like the taming of the Troodon and Noglin, you have to make creatures near the Narcler unconscious and go away quickly until he is beginning to consume the torpor, then you just have to repeat this process until it‘s torpor storage is full and you have achieved taming a Narcler!
